We start with the data model, not the screens

Most web applications that become painful to change were painful from the first schema. A data model that mirrors how the business actually works absorbs new requirements quietly; one that mirrors the first set of screens has to be renegotiated every time the product grows.

So the first week is spent on entities and relationships — what a customer is, what an order is, what happens when one is cancelled halfway through. We write that down and walk you through it before a single interface is designed. It is the cheapest hour of the project and the one that saves the most later.

Boring technology, chosen on purpose

We build on Next.js, TypeScript, Laravel, Node and PostgreSQL — not because they are fashionable but because they have long support windows, deep documentation and a large hiring pool. When you need to bring the work in-house or hire a second agency, you will not be looking for specialists in something we invented.

Where a project genuinely needs something less common we will say so and explain the trade-off, including what it will cost you in hiring terms three years out.

Performance is a build-time decision

Speed is not something you add at the end. Server-side rendering, sensible caching layers, indexed queries and images processed at build time are architectural choices that cost nothing to make early and a rewrite to retrofit.

Every platform we ship is measured against Core Web Vitals on real devices before launch, not just in a lab, and the numbers go in the handover document alongside the queries that produce them.

Built so you can take it over

The measure of a good build is that you stop needing us. Every project ships with a test suite that runs in CI, a README that gets a new engineer running locally in under an hour, architectural decision records explaining why things are the way they are, and a recorded walkthrough of the system.

We also run a handover session with your engineers where they drive and we answer questions. Teams that have done this are typically shipping their own features within a week.

Process

How a web & software project runs

  1. 01

    Model the domain

    Interviews with the people who do the work today, then a written data model and architecture proposal. You approve it before anything is built.

  2. 02

    Walking skeleton

    In sprint one we ship the thinnest end-to-end slice — one real workflow, deployed, authenticated, in your cloud account. Everything after is filling it in.

  3. 03

    Sprint and review

    Two-week sprints, each ending with a deployed build on a staging URL and a session where you use it. Scope closes at the halfway point.

  4. 04

    Harden and hand over

    Load testing, error budgets, monitoring and alerting, then documentation and a live walkthrough with your engineers driving.

Can you take over a codebase someone else started?
Yes, and it is a large share of what we do. We start with a two-week technical audit so we can tell you what we found before quoting the work — occasionally that report concludes the honest answer is a rewrite, and we would rather say so upfront than discover it in month three.
Do you write tests, and does that cost extra?
Tests are included, not an upsell. We target around 85% coverage on business logic at handover, with end-to-end tests on the critical paths. Untested code is slower to change, which makes it more expensive for you later, so treating tests as optional would be a false saving.
Whose cloud account does it run in?
Yours, wherever possible. We work inside your AWS, GCP or Vercel account and your GitHub organisation from day one. You keep the billing relationship, the audit trail and the ability to revoke our access at any point.
What if requirements change mid-project?
Small changes get absorbed. Anything that alters the agreed scope gets priced as a change before we build it, so the number never moves without your sign-off. We close scope at the halfway point of a build — after that, new ideas go on the list for the next phase rather than destabilising the release.
Can you work alongside our in-house engineers?
Often, and it usually produces the best handover. We work in your repositories, follow your review process and pair with your team on the parts they will own. It slows the first sprint slightly and saves months afterwards.
